The Wednesday early-close

One quirk most people do not know: most SSA field offices nationwide, including El Paso, close earlier on Wednesdays — typically around noon. This is to give staff time to process the backlog of cases without the pressure of walk-ins. If you plan a Wednesday afternoon visit, you will likely find the office closed.

If you need afternoon service, plan for Monday, Tuesday, Thursday, or Friday. Mornings are universally busier than afternoons, so if your schedule is flexible, an afternoon non-Wednesday visit usually has the shortest wait.

Federal holidays when the office is closed

  • New Year's Day (January 1).
  • Martin Luther King Jr. Day (third Monday in January).
  • Presidents Day (third Monday in February).
  • Memorial Day (last Monday in May).
  • Juneteenth National Independence Day (June 19).
  • Independence Day (July 4).
  • Labor Day (first Monday in September).
  • Columbus Day (second Monday in October).
  • Veterans Day (November 11).
  • Thanksgiving Day (fourth Thursday in November).
  • Christmas Day (December 25).

How to use the office hours efficiently

The best practice: schedule an appointment in advance by calling 1-800-772-1213, regardless of the hours. With an appointment, you will be seen close to your scheduled time even on busy days. Walk-ins are accepted but can mean 1-2 hour waits at peak times.

If you only need a quick service (like updating your address or requesting a benefit verification), check first whether you can do it online at ssa.gov — many of these no longer require an office visit at all.

Frequently asked questions

Is the El Paso office open on weekends?

No. All SSA field offices, including El Paso, are closed on Saturdays and Sundays. Use ssa.gov for any service available online.

What if I arrive close to closing time?

You may be turned away if there is not enough time to process your visit. Plan to arrive at least 30 minutes before closing — and earlier on Wednesdays, when the office closes around noon.

Can I call the office directly to confirm hours?

Direct local phone lines for field offices have been replaced by the national line at 1-800-772-1213. That number can confirm current hours for the El Paso office.

Are the hours different around holidays?

Yes. Around major holidays, the office may have modified hours in addition to the holiday closure itself. Always confirm before visiting during holiday weeks.
